Frozen Sunset Over Caesar Creek
The Story: This colorful sunset served as a visual reward following a winter visit to Caesar Creek State Park, near Waynesville, Ohio. Over the previous weeks, I witnessed ice trying to form over one of Ohio’s deepest lakes. On this day, as I discovered a new overlook, I was taken back by the view before me. This winter was so cold that Caesar Creek developed pressure ridges of ice. I found the spectacle compositionally intriguing as the broken ice formed leading lines toward the sinking sun.
